A Wall Street Journal report this week predicts national spending on cable advertising will end the year up 12%. While questions remain about the stability of the economy overall, analysts still expect overall growth in the U.S. ad market to be 2% for the year.

2011 Online Ad Market Due to Increase
Wednesday, Aug 25, 2010
The ad market has been slowly recovering this year. Many analysts expect to see stronger growth in 2011. This includes Borrell Associates which has just come out with its 2011 forecast. The research concern is predicting a total U.S. ad market of $238.6 billion in 2011 which represents an increase of about 5% over this year.
